| /* ------------------------------------------------------------------ */
 | |
| /* decContextDefault -- initialize a context structure                */
 | |
| /*                                                                    */
 | |
| /*  context is the structure to be initialized                        */
 | |
| /*  kind selects the required set of default values, one of:          */
 | |
| /*      DEC_INIT_BASE       -- select ANSI X3-274 defaults            */
 | |
| /*      DEC_INIT_DECIMAL32  -- select IEEE 754 defaults, 32-bit       */
 | |
| /*      DEC_INIT_DECIMAL64  -- select IEEE 754 defaults, 64-bit       */
 | |
| /*      DEC_INIT_DECIMAL128 -- select IEEE 754 defaults, 128-bit      */
 | |
| /*      For any other value a valid context is returned, but with     */
 | |
| /*      Invalid_operation set in the status field.                    */
 | |
| /*  returns a context structure with the appropriate initial values.  */
 | |
| /* ------------------------------------------------------------------ */
 | |
| U_CAPI decContext *  U_EXPORT2 uprv_decContextDefault(decContext *context, Int kind) {
 | |
|   /* set defaults...  */
 | |
|   context->digits=9;                         /* 9 digits  */
 | |
|   context->emax=DEC_MAX_EMAX;                /* 9-digit exponents  */
 | |
|   context->emin=DEC_MIN_EMIN;                /* .. balanced  */
 | |
|   context->round=DEC_ROUND_HALF_UP;          /* 0.5 rises  */
 | |
|   context->traps=DEC_Errors;                 /* all but informational  */
 | |
|   context->status=0;                         /* cleared  */
 | |
|   context->clamp=0;                          /* no clamping  */
 | |
|   #if DECSUBSET
 | |
|   context->extended=0;                       /* cleared  */
 | |
|   #endif
 | |
|   switch (kind) {
 | |
|     case DEC_INIT_BASE:
 | |
|       /* [use defaults]  */
 | |
|       break;
 | |
|     case DEC_INIT_DECIMAL32:
 | |
|       context->digits=7;                     /* digits  */
 | |
|       context->emax=96;                      /* Emax  */
 | |
|       context->emin=-95;                     /* Emin  */
 | |
|       context->round=DEC_ROUND_HALF_EVEN;    /* 0.5 to nearest even  */
 | |
|       context->traps=0;                      /* no traps set  */
 | |
|       context->clamp=1;                      /* clamp exponents  */
 | |
|       #if DECSUBSET
 | |
|       context->extended=1;                   /* set  */
 | |
|       #endif
 | |
|       break;
 | |
|     case DEC_INIT_DECIMAL64:
 | |
|       context->digits=16;                    /* digits  */
 | |
|       context->emax=384;                     /* Emax  */
 | |
|       context->emin=-383;                    /* Emin  */
 | |
|       context->round=DEC_ROUND_HALF_EVEN;    /* 0.5 to nearest even  */
 | |
|       context->traps=0;                      /* no traps set  */
 | |
|       context->clamp=1;                      /* clamp exponents  */
 | |
|       #if DECSUBSET
 | |
|       context->extended=1;                   /* set  */
 | |
|       #endif
 | |
|       break;
 | |
|     case DEC_INIT_DECIMAL128:
 | |
|       context->digits=34;                    /* digits  */
 | |
|       context->emax=6144;                    /* Emax  */
 | |
|       context->emin=-6143;                   /* Emin  */
 | |
|       context->round=DEC_ROUND_HALF_EVEN;    /* 0.5 to nearest even  */
 | |
|       context->traps=0;                      /* no traps set  */
 | |
|       context->clamp=1;                      /* clamp exponents  */
 | |
|       #if DECSUBSET
 | |
|       context->extended=1;                   /* set  */
 | |
|       #endif
 | |
|       break;
 | |
| 
 | |
|     default:                                 /* invalid Kind  */
 | |
|       /* use defaults, and ..  */
 | |
|       uprv_decContextSetStatus(context, DEC_Invalid_operation); /* trap  */
 | |
|     }
 | |
| 
 | |
|   return context;} /* decContextDefault  */
